Quisor F1

Quisor F1 is a hybrid tomato variety .It has  high yield, robust growth, and excellent fruit quality. It is specially bred for resistance to common tomato diseases and pests, making it a reliable choice for both commercial growers and home gardeners. The fruits of Quisor F1 are typically large, uniform, and have a good balance of sweetness and acidity.

Features

  • Growth Habit: Indeterminate growth habit, meaning it continues to grow and produce fruit throughout the growing season.
  • Size: Medium to large fruits, typically weighing between 180-200 grams.
  • Shape: Round to slightly flattened.
  • Color: Bright red when fully ripe.
  • Texture: Firm and juicy with a smooth skin.
  • Maturity: Early maturing variety, with fruits ready for harvest approximately 70-75 days after transplanting.
  • Yield: High yielding, capable of producing a large number of fruits per plant.
  • Disease Resistance: Resistant to several common tomato diseases, including Verticillium wilt, Fusarium wilt, and Tomato Mosaic Virus.
  • Flavor: Well-balanced flavor profile with a good mix of sweetness and acidity, making it ideal for fresh consumption and processing.

Application

  • Select high-quality seeds from a reliable source.
  • Start seeds indoors 6-8 weeks before the last expected frost or sow directly in the field after the risk of frost has passed.
  • Sow seeds 1/4 inch deep in seed trays or directly in the field.
  • Transplant seedlings outdoors when they are 6-8 weeks old and have developed several true leaves. Space plants 18-24 inches apart in rows spaced 36-48 inches apart.
  • Prefers well-drained, fertile soil with a pH between 6.0 and 7.0. Incorporate compost or well-rotted manure into the soil before planting.
  • Requires full sun, receiving at least 6-8 hours of direct sunlight daily. Water consistently, keeping the soil evenly moist but not waterlogged.
  • Apply a balanced fertilizer at planting and side-dress with a nitrogen-rich fertilizer during the growing season to support vigorous growth and fruit development.
  • Monitor for common pests such as aphids, tomato hornworms, and whiteflies. Use organic pesticides, row covers, and crop rotation to manage pests and diseases. Encourage beneficial insects to help control pest populations.

Storage

Store Quisor F1 tomato seeds in a cool, dry place. Use airtight containers to protect from moisture and pests. Properly stored seeds can remain viable for up to five years.
